Cinema Fearité Presents ‘Sole Survivor’ – An Eighties Precursor To 21st Century Horror

March 30, 2017 by James Jay Edwards

Last week, Cinema Fearité brought you Offerings, an eighties slasher that was just behind its time.  This week, we’re heading to the other end of the scale by featuring a movie that was years ahead of its time.  That movie is 1983’s Sole Survivor.
